20 Barcelona Jerseys in 2 Days
In a joint project of unprecedented scale, Barcelona-based Nerea Palacios and British artist Angelo Trofa have created 20 different Barcelona shirts in just two days.
Ranging from the big players like Adidas and Nike to the more niche brands of Mizuno or Penalty, Palacios and Trofa aspired to capture the essential design foundations of each of them. This lead to a range of different shirts, although they all stay true to the Blaugrana colors iconic to the club.

Chattanooga Red Wolves Reveal Vibrant Hispanic Heritage Pre-Match Shirt
USL League One club Chattanooga Red Wolves SC have unveiled a striking special-edition warm-up top in celebration of Hispanic Heritage Month. Worn ahead of the club's annual Hispanic Heritage Night celebrations, the design pays homage to the rich cultural contributions and traditions of the Hispanic and Latino communities within the local area and across the sport.
Set against an off-white base, the standout feature of the shirt is a massive howling wolf graphic across the front. The silhouette of the club's emblem is brought to life through intricate Mesoamerican and folk art motifs, filled with vibrant shades of teal, red, yellow, orange, and violet. Matching cultural diamond patterns run down the red side panels, while the sleeve cuffs are detailed with horizontal sequences representing various Latin American flags.
The reverse side continues the celebratory theme with a sun wheel and mythological fauna gracing the upper back. Centered below is the club's rallying cry, "DALE LOBOS," printed in a bold red textured font and framed by geometric borders.
US Cremonese 26-27 Third Kit Released
Italian club US Cremonese and technical sponsor Acerbis have officially unveiled their new third kit for the 2026-27 campaign. Designed by Cremona native Carlo Enrico Bonvicini, the jersey is built around a deep navy base enhanced by an alternating pattern of glossy and matte tonal pinstripes for subtle depth.
Elegant golden trim outlines the classic polo collar and sleeve cuffs, complemented by monochrome gold sponsor branding and a reimagined two-tone club crest that references 1980s and 1990s iconography alongside the historical Giovanni Baldesio legend.
